Created by the talented  [Link To User poulynoe] Prompt: "How do we develop spiritual discipline?"

I spent a whole semester learning about this very subject so spiritual discipline is a little deeper than you may believe. Whether I can define it and describe it in the little bit of time I have is hard. However, spiritual discipline refers basically to developing good spiritual habits. The beginning is prayer. It is hard for us to get into a habit of praying because we are so distracted. There is always something on our minds, even if it's last night's dinner reminding us that it disagreed with us. The second discipline is meditation. This is listening for God and there are different ways of doing it. I am not going to elaborate here. The third discipline is Bible study. You decide how much you are going to read. I have set out to read every English translation I can get at least once. Currently, I am reading the New Living Translation on my android device. Next, I plan to read the New Revised Standard Version. I have read all the New Testament and prophets on my android. I am finishing the Law and then I will tackle Joshua through Ezra.

As most people know if they know me, I am a student at Regent University in the Master of Divinity program. Two of the requirements for graduation are that I complete an internship and a one-year residency at a Clinical Pastoral Education (CPE) certified training site. I was told that there are only 300 such sites in the entire country and those are located in 30 cities across the country. The chances were that I would be forced to move to complete my degree. I usually can't afford to go out to lunch, yet again up and move. Moving would have meant coming up with a security deposit on an apartment and hundreds of other costs that I could never afford. It would have been next to impossible for me to have done so and thus next to impossible to complete my degree. I checked into the locations of the CPE training site and it turns out that two of those sites are right here in West Virginia. One is at Ruby Memorial Hospital AKA WVU Medical Center. The other is at St. Mary's Medical Center, which is now part of Marshall University Medical Center. I graduated from Marshall University last year. prior to graduating, I rode public transportation to class every day. One of the designated stops for the bus is St. Mary's Medical Center, the CPE site that offers the residency I need! Man, I was so excited to find that out that I did not even sleep that night! God moved me here to the WVVH two years ago, knowing that we were practically a stone's throw from a CPE certified training site, which is about as rare as a royal flush. God knew I would need to be close to such a site and He arranged for me to be located perfectly to meet that need! I do not believe in coincidences!
